Because your roof is constantly exposed to the weather, it means your roof is will break down with time. The speed at which it deteriorates will be dependent on a range of variables. These include; the quality of the original components used and the craftsmanship, the amount of abuse it will have to take from the weather, how well the roof is preserved and the style of the roof. Most roofing companies will quote around 20 years for a well-built and properly maintained roof, but that can never be promised as a result of the above variables. Our advice is to consistently keep your roof well maintained and get regular roof inspections to make sure it lasts as long as possible.
You shouldn’t ever pressure-wash your roof, as you run the risk of getting rid of any protective minerals that have been included to give cover from the weather. Additionally, you really should try to stay away from chlorine-based bleach cleaning products since they can easily also decrease the life-span of your roof. When you speak to your roof cleaning professional, tell them to use an EPA-approved algaecide/fungicide to wash your roof. This will clear away the unpleasant algae and staining without ruining the tile or shingles.

Mounds is a village in Creek County, Oklahoma, United States. It is located just south of Tulsa; the town’s population was 1,168 at the 2010 census, an increase of 1.3 percent from 1,153 at the 2000 census.[5]
The post office for this community was established in 1895 and originally named “Posey”, for the Creek poet Alexander Posey, who lived in Eufaula, Oklahoma. In 1898, the town was moved 5 miles (8 km) southwest and renamed “Mounds” for twin hills that were nearby. By 1901, the St. Louis, Oklahoma and Southern Railway (later the St. Louis and San Francisco Railway) built a track through Mounds, and the town became an important cattle shipping point. Mounds incorporated as a city in the same year. The discovery of oil in the Glenn Pool field in 1905 turned Mounds into a shipping point for crude oil instead of cattle.[6]

Wood shakes deal a natural appearance with a lot of character. Because of variations in color, width, density, and cut of the wood, no 2 shake roofing systems will ever look the same. Wood uses some energy advantages, too. It assists to insulate the attic, and it permits your house to breathe, circulating air through the little openings under the felt rows on which wood shingles are laid.
Mold, rot and pests can become an issue. The life-cycle cost of a shake roof might be high, and old shakes can’t be recycled. The majority of wood shakes are unrated by fire security codes. Numerous usage clean or spray-on fire retardants, which provide less defense and are only efficient for a couple of years.
Installing wood shakes is more complicated than roofing with composite shingles, and the quality of the finished roofing system depends upon the experience of the contractor, as well as the caliber of the shakes used. The finest shakes originated from the heartwood of big, old cedar trees, which are challenging to discover.

Concrete tiles are made from extruded concrete that is colored. Standard roofing tiles are made from clay. Concrete and clay tile roof are resilient, aesthetically appealing, and low in maintenance. They likewise supply energy cost savings and are eco-friendly. Although product and installation expenses are higher for concrete and clay tile roofing systems, when evaluated on a price-versus-performance basis, they might out-perform other roofing products.
In truth, since of its severe durability, longevity and security, roofing system tile is the most common roof material on the planet. Tested over centuries, roofing tile can successfully withstand the most extreme weather conditions including hail, high wind, earthquakes, scorching heat, and severe freeze-thaw cycles. Concrete and clay roof tiles also have genuine Class A fire rankings, which means that, when set up according to developing code, roofing system tile is non-combustible and keeps that quality throughout its life time.
Since the ultimate durability of a tile roofing also depends on the quality of the sub-roof, roofing tile makers are likewise working to improve flashings and other elements of the underlayment system. Under normal circumstances, appropriately set up tile roofs are virtually maintenance-free. Unlike other roof products, roofing tiles actually become stronger over time.

Concrete and clay tile roofing systems are likewise energy-efficient, assisting to keep livable interior temperatures (in both cold and warm climates) at a lower expense than other roof. Because of the thermal capability of roofing system tiles and the ventilated air area that their placement on the roofing system surface area creates, a tile roof can reduce air-conditioning costs in hotter climates, and produce more continuous temperatures in chillier areas, which minimizes potential ice build-up.
They are produced without making use of chemical preservatives, and do not deplete limited natural deposits. Single-ply membranes are versatile sheets of intensified artificial products that are made in a factory. There are three kinds of membranes: thermosets, thermoplastics, and modified bitumens. These materials supply strength, flexibility, and lasting durability.
They are inherently flexible, used in a range of accessory systems, and intensified for long-lasting toughness and water tight stability for years of roof life. Thermoset membranes are compounded from rubber polymers. The most typically utilized polymer is EPDM (often described as “rubber roofing”). Thermoset membranes make effective roofing products due to the fact that they can endure the potentially destructive effects of sunshine and most typical chemicals usually found on roofing systems.
Thermoplastic membranes are based on plastic polymers. The most common thermoplastic is PVC (polyvinyl chloride) which has actually been made flexible through the inclusion of particular ingredients called plasticizers. Thermoplastic membranes are identified by seams that are formed utilizing either heat or chemical welding. These joints are as strong or more powerful than the membrane itself.
Modified bitumen membranes are hybrids that incorporate the state-of-the-art solution and pre-fabrication benefits of single-ply with a few of the conventional setup strategies utilized in built-up roofing. These products are factory-fabricated layers of asphalt, “modified” utilizing a rubber or plastic ingredient for increased flexibility, and integrated with reinforcement for added strength and stability.
The type of modifier utilized may determine the method of sheet setup. Some are mopped down using hot asphalt, and some use torches to melt the asphalt so that it flows onto the substrate. The joints are sealed by the same method.
